56 Bel Air Fuel Gauge not functioning

Ok second question for the group.  My fathers 56' Chevy Bel Air that he has gifted to me is in pretty good shape, however some small things need to be done.  The first one i want to tackle is the fuel gauge does not work.  It shows empty at all times.  Any tips, tricks or suggestions?  Is it hard to fix?  too expensive?

hello..there is a wire running to the top of the sending unit on top of tank..look there and ok check wire at both ends to see if its still in one piece/conducts...also if it is the gauge ,there are several gauge repair shops that will fix your stock one.. or buy a new one > http://www.classicchevy.com/interior-parts-and-trim/gauges.html
